Common Failures of MG 10001582 Ignition coil wiring harness for MG6/MG550

  • Wiring Breakage: Common in MG6 and MG550 with OE number 10001582 ignition coil wiring harness, often due to long - term vibration.
  • Insulation Damage: Leads to short - circuits in the ignition coil wiring harness of MG models with OE 10001582, affecting ignition performance.
  • Connection Loosening: A frequent issue in the 10001582 wiring harness of MG6 and MG550, causing unstable ignition.

Maintenance Tips of MG 10001582 Ignition coil wiring harness for MG6/MG550

  • First, when servicing the Ignition coil wiring harness of MG6 or MG550 with OE number 10001582, check for any visible damages. Look for frayed wires or loose connections.
  • Secondly, ensure proper insulation. A good quality wiring harness like this one from MG should have excellent insulation to prevent short - circuits.
  • Next, match the connector pins precisely. Incorrect pin - matching can lead to misfires and engine performance issues.
  • Moreover, route the wiring harness correctly. Avoid sharp edges that could cut the wires.
  • Finally, use a multimeter to test the electrical conductivity. This helps to confirm that the Ignition coil wiring harness is functioning as it should.
Warning: Always disconnect the battery before installing the Ignition coil wiring harness (OE# 10001582) for MG6/MG550 to prevent electrical shocks.
